On the day BNB broke a new high, He Yi, @Yi He , as a co-founder of Binance, graced the cover of Fortune magazine 🧗♀️. This also marks the recognition of He Yi's achievements and capabilities as a co-founder of Binance!
One part of the article that impressed me deeply was this:
"In her life and career, He Yi has overcome many obstacles—one of which was learning English. Four years ago, she started learning English at the age of thirty-five or thirty-six. During a long Zoom interview, He Yi performed exceptionally well, only seeking help from a translator when she encountered difficulties explaining a Chinese idiom or proverb."
